2

Прочитав этот замечательный пост от HN, я теперь изучаю варианты резервного копирования моей учетной записи Gmail.

Я хотел бы систему, с помощью которой я могу

  • Автоматизируйте резервное копирование с помощью задания cron
  • Зашифровать мои резервные копии (на самом деле не часть процесса резервного копирования)
  • Храните резервные копии таким образом, чтобы я мог отправлять их в Amazon S3 (например, tarball)
  • Инкрементное резервное копирование (т. Е. Сценарий резервного копирования должен иметь возможность принимать дату «резервного копирования с»)
  • Иметь возможность вернуть мои электронные письма в их текущее состояние (т.е. поддерживать ярлыки)

До сих пор я не смог найти ничего, что могло бы достичь вышеупомянутого, но я думаю, что для любого, имеющего учетную запись Gmail, очень важно сделать хорошие резервные копии ваших электронных писем (и я рекомендовал бы прочитать связанную статью для всех, кто не имеет ).

У кого-нибудь есть хорошая идея для решения вышеуказанного?

2 ответа2

2

BaGoMa может быть то, что вы ищете. Это скрипт Python для резервного копирования / восстановления почты Gmail. Использует IMAP, но умен, так что он загружает каждое сообщение только один раз, независимо от того, сколько меток он применил к нему, и все же он будет поддерживать метки и флаги (чтение, пометка и т.д.) Для восстановления.

Никогда не удаляет сообщения из вашей учетной записи Gmail. Восстановление только загружает отсутствующие сообщения из локального хранилища, оно не пытается синхронизировать вашу учетную запись с ее содержимым. Кроме того, резервное копирование также не удаляет сообщения из локального хранилища. Существует отдельная компактная команда, которая удаляет сообщения из локального хранилища, если они не существуют на сервере Gmail.

Поскольку резервное копирование почты осуществляется только через IMAP, оно не может / не может получать определенные вещи: контакты, чаты, фильтры (и другие параметры), суперзвезд, ярлыки, которые вы решили скрыть из IMAP (представьте себе!), И корзину / Спам.

1

BaGoMa выглядит лучше, но я использую getmail и правило для gmail, чтобы добавить метку к почте, для которой я хочу сделать резервную копию.

Он также использует IMAP, хранит данные в формате mbox на локальном диске и может быть легко зашифрован.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.